Given:
Coordinates of point A are (7,3).
Point B is on the x-axis whose abscissa is 11.
To find:
The distance between A and B.
Solution:
Point B is on the x-axis whose abscissa is 11. So, x-coordinate of the point B is 11 and y-coordinate is 0. It means, coordinates of point B are (11,0).
The distance between A(7,3) and B(11,0) is






Therefore, the distance between point A and B is 5 units.

A geometric sequence is a sequence in which each term of the sequence is obtained by multiplying/dividing by a common value, called the common ratio, to the preceding term. Given a sequence, we can determine whether the sequence is arithmetic, geometric or neither by comparing the terms of the sequence.
